#[repr(C)]pub struct IActivateAudioInterfaceCompletionHandler {
pub lpVtbl: *const IActivateAudioInterfaceCompletionHandlerVtbl,
}
Fields§
§lpVtbl: *const IActivateAudioInterfaceCompletionHandlerVtbl
Implementations§
Source§impl IActivateAudioInterfaceCompletionHandler
impl IActivateAudioInterfaceCompletionHandler
pub unsafe fn ActivateCompleted( &self, activateOperation: *mut IActivateAudioInterfaceAsyncOperation, ) -> HRESULT
Trait Implementations§
Auto Trait Implementations§
impl Freeze for IActivateAudioInterfaceCompletionHandler
impl RefUnwindSafe for IActivateAudioInterfaceCompletionHandler
impl !Send for IActivateAudioInterfaceCompletionHandler
impl !Sync for IActivateAudioInterfaceCompletionHandler
impl Unpin for IActivateAudioInterfaceCompletionHandler
impl UnwindSafe for IActivateAudioInterfaceCompletionHandler
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more